Wire and arc additive manufacturing (WAAM) is the most advanced technique used to fabricate desired parts by depositing material in layer-by-layer sequence. WAAM can produce medium and large sized components with higher deposition rates, low manufacturing cost and less production time. Mechanical and metallurgical properties of WAAM based products are much better and suited for aerospace engineering. WAAM is still under examination because of challenges like porosity, corrosion, delamination, residual stresses and oxidation. From the literature review, it has observed that the metals like titanium, aluminum, steels & nickel alloys can be used in WAAM process. In this paper, the various technologies and process advancements such as inter pass cold rolling, inter pass cooling, peening effect and weld pool oscillation have been discussed in detail.
